FIELD: toxicology.;SUBSTANCE: invention relates to sanitary toxicology and can be used to determine the content of fumaric and maleic acids in blood plasma by the method of high performance liquid chromatography (HPLC). Blood sample is centrifuged, plasma is separated and adjusted to pH 1 with concentrated phosphoric acid. Carry out solid phase plasma extraction by successively passing acetonitrile (AC), distilled water, plasma, and 5 % aqueous solution of AC through Oasis HLB 1CC sorbent. Extract the analytes from the cartridge by passing through it a clean AC. Extract is dried under vacuum, the dry residue is redissolved in methanol and passed through a membrane filter. Conduct a subsequent study of the extract using HPLC. Number of fumaric and maleic acids set on the calibration curve.;EFFECT: invention provides an increase in the sensitivity and selectivity of the separate determination of the content of fumaric and maleic acids in the blood and makes it possible to diagnose the chemical load of chemical workers.;4 cl, 8 tbl
